As Senior AI Solution Consultant you sit between the problem and the solution: you take a broad, messy client ask, structure it, decide what is worth solving, and shape the AI solution for it, one that holds up under regulation and that people will actually use. You don't write production code. You make sure the right thing gets built, that someone decides, and that it can be proven to work.
-
Use Case Ownership: Take a broad, messy client ask through to a decision people stand behind, with the business value made explicit and the trade-offs written down.
-
Problem Framing: Make competing asks comparable, decide what gets solved first, and put the reasoning on the table.
-
Stakeholder Reality: Bring the people who ask for a solution and the people who will work with it behind one decision.
-
AI Judgment: Draw the line between what AI should do and what it should not, and say what has to be measured for people to trust the result.
-
Structured Intent: Capture the what and the why, so that engineers and AI agents can build the how.
-
High-Stakes Facilitation: Design and run formats with senior stakeholders from product, engineering and compliance, producing alignment in the room.
-
Rapid Prototyping: Put a working artefact in front of a stakeholder instead of a concept, using today's AI tooling.
-
Client Capability: Build enablement formats, reusable AI artefacts and skills that client teams operate themselves after we leave.
-
Governance Early: Bring classification, controls, auditability and cost implications into the picture at the start, not at the end.
-
Multiplication: Turn what you learn into playbooks and templates your colleagues use in their own delivery.
-
Structured Thinking: You give shape to something vague, form a view early, and stay sharp when you go deeper.
-
Product Thinking: Strong instinct for value and users, and you can say what a use case is worth before anyone builds it.
-
Consulting Track Record: Several years in consulting, product or transformation roles, ideally in regulated industries, with topics you carried to a decision rather than only contributed to.
-
AI Judgment: Clear-eyed on where LLMs fit and where they do not, on the failure modes, and on how to prove an output is correct. You work with your own workflows, agents and skills, and stay critical of what comes back.
-
Technical Fluency: Confident in conversations on modern software delivery, LLMs, agents and RAG, without needing to build production systems yourself.
-
Composure: You hold a position under pressure with senior people, and change it when someone brings the better argument.
-
AI Governance is a plus: EU AI Act risk classification, human-in-the-loop, auditability, any exposure to DORA or GDPR/DPIA.
-
Languages: Fluent communication in German and English.
